honestly, its just free advertising. the reason people are allowed to post gameplay videos without the risk of violating copyright is because they arent uploading the full experience. you cant get everything out of a game if you are just watching it.

never have i seen videos of a game a really wanted to play, only to go, "well, i guess i dont have any reason to play it now".

the only time gameplay videos turn me off of purchasing a game is if they dont look fun to play. ive watched full walkthroughs of story driven games, but if those videos didnt exist, i sure as hell wouldnt have bothered to buy the games, as the gameplay didnt entice me.
